Edison.Gates and Microsoft only made it because IBM was looking for an operating system for their new PC's and chose DOS and it grew as PC's grew. It was the growth of PC's that made Microsoft since they clinched the market by default by being the first ones in. . What they did was not rocket science. Gates was just in the right place at the right time. Edison did some real invention and innovation. Edison was also good with business; his company was General Electric.
